APSC AE Recruitment 2025: 50 Vacancies
The total number of vacancies is 50, out of which 26 are for UR candidates (7 reserved for women), 14 reserved for OBC/MOBC (4 reserved for women), 1 reserved for SC, 7 reserved for STP, and 2 reserved for STH. Total, there are 50 posts, out of which 11 are reserved for women.
These vacancies comes under the Public Health Engineering Department.
Pay Scale
The pay scale for the post is Rs 30,000-Rs 1,10,000, in Pay Band 4 with a grade pay of Rs 12,700. Along with the basic pay, selected candidates would also be entitled to other allowances as admissible to the Assam State Government Employees from time to time (per month).
Eligibility Criteria
Candidates applying for the post should fulfill the eligibility criteria.
- Candidate must be citizen of India as per the article 5 to 8 of Indian constitution. Article 5 to 8 of Indian Constitution is given here.
- Candidate must be a resident of Assam.
- As domicile proof, candidate must upload a copy of valid Permanent resident certificate issued in Assam for educational purpose/Employment Exchange Registration Certificate will also be treated as residency proof.
Age limit
Candidate should be at least 21 years old and less than 38 years old as on 1st January 2025, however age relaxation is applicable to SC, ST, OBC and other candidates as per the rules. Age relaxation given to various candidates are
- By 5 years for SC/ST candidates, i.e. upto 43 years.
- By 3 years for OBC/MOBC candidates i.e. upto 41 years as per Govt. Notification No. ABP. 6/2016/9 dated Dispur the 25th April 2018.
- For Ex-Servicemen, the maximum age shall be 50 years as on 01-01-2025 for Unreserved category, relaxable further by 3 (Three) years for OBC/MOBC candidates and 5 (Five) years for SC/ST candidates.
- Persons with benchmark disability (PwBD) 10 years irrespective of SC/ST/OBC and UR Category of candidates as per Govt. Memorandum No. ABP 144/95/121 dated Dispur the 28th October, 2015.
The age limit of the candidates will be calculated on the basis of the Class-X/Class-XII Examination Admit Card/Pass Certificate/Marksheet issued by a recognized Central/State Board/Council where Age/Date of Birth (DOB) is clearly reflected.
No other document shall be accepted in lieu of the above mentioned documents for age proof.
Educational Qualification
B.E/B.Tech specifically in Civil/Mechanical/Chemical Engineering from any institute recognised by AICTE.
Or
Part A & B of AMIE (India) in Civil/Mechanical/Chemical Engineering enrolled on or before 31.05.2013. (Upload relevant all semester/year mark sheet/certificate reflecting the subjects)
Starting Date of Online Application: 15th September 2025
Closing Date of Online Application: 14th October 2025
Last Date for Payment of Application Fee: 16th October 2025
Application Fee:
The application fee for various candidates are given below:
S.No. | Category | Application Fee (In Rs) | Processing Fee Charged by CSC-SPV (in Rs) | Taxable amount on processing fee (@18%) | Total amount (in Rs) |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
1. | Unreserved | 250 | 40 | 7.20 | 297.20 |
2. | OBC/MOBC | 150 | 40 | 7.20 | 197.20 |
3. | SC/ST/BPL/PwBD | 0 | 40 | 7.20 | 47.20 |
To avail fee relaxation, candidates must produce certificate of the claimed category issued by the relevant authority.
Applications without the prescribed fee would not be considered and summarily rejected. No representation against such rejection would be entertained.
Fees once paid shall not be refunded under any circumstances nor can the fees be held in reserve for any other examination or selection.

How to apply
- Applicants are required to apply online through APSC’s recruitment website. No other means/mode of application will be accepted.
- Applicants who have not registered yet, in Online Recruitment Portal of APSC are first required to go to the APSC’s recruitment website https://apscrecruitment.in and register themselves by clicking on ‘Register Here‘ link and complete the One Time Registration (OTR) process by providing basic details.
- CANDIDATES ARE ADVISED TO REGISTER WITH VALID AND ACTIVE E-MAIL ADDRESS AND MOBILE NUMBER IN THE ONLINE APPLICATION.
- After registration, applicants should log in using their registered e-mail/mobile number and password.
- After login, applicants need to provide the required registration details as asked in the form.
- Applicants must carefully read the eligibility criteria and other relevant details before applying. Mandatory fields are marked with an asterisk (*).
- Applicants must upload the required documents/certificates (e.g. Date of Birth, Educational Qualifications, caste/category etc.) in PDF format, ensuring that:
- File size does not exceed 4 MB
- The file is legible in print
- Scanning is done at 200 dpi in greyscale (recommended).
- Applicants must upload their recent Photograph (size: 50 KB – 200 KB, not older than 3 months) and Signature (size: 50 KB – 200 KВ).
- Uploaded documents will be verified at later stages of the recruitment process.
- Applicants should fill all details carefully and tick the declaration checkbox to enable the Preview option before final submission.
- No editing of the application will be allowed after final submission. Applicants must therefore ensure all details and uploads are correct.
- Before submission, applicants should check uploaded documents (educational qualification, age proof, caste certificate, etc.) using the Preview option to confirm that the documents are clear and legible.
- After previewing, applicants may either click ‘Proceed to Pay’ to continue or ‘Cancel’ to make necessary corrections.
- On completion of the form, applicants must pay the prescribed fee/charges, as applicable.
- Fee once paid will not be refunded.
- In case of payment failure/pending, applicants should click ‘Check Status’ to verify payment with the bank/GRAS. In instances of double debit i.e. amount debited more than once for the same transaction, bank will automatically refund the fee within 5-7 working days.
- Upon successful submission, an auto-generated confirmation e-mail/SMS will be sent to the registered e-mail ID/Mobile No.
- Applications will not be considered valid unless the fee payment is completed.
- Applicants may also fill their form through Common Service Centres (CSCs). Those without debit card/Internet banking facilities may visit the nearest CSC.
- After final submission, applicants must take a print-out of the submitted Online Application Form and retain the hard copy for future reference.
- The candidates are advised to submit the Online Recruitment Application well in advance without waiting for the closing date.

Documents required at the time of Interview
Those candidates who would qualify for the interview would need to present the following document failing which the candidate would not be allowed to appear in the Interview.
- The hardcopy of the online application and the following Original Documents/Certificates along with Self attested copies and other items specified in the Intimation Letter.
- Interview admit card
- Class-X/Class-XII Examination, Admit Card/Pass Certificate/ Marksheet issued by Central/State Board clearly indicating Date of Birth in support of their claim of age.
- Certificates & Mark sheets of all examinations from HSLC onwards up to the level of qualifying examination.
- E/B.Tech/Part A & B of AMIE certificate along with mark-sheets pertaining to all the academic semester/ years as proof of educational qualification claimed. In the absence of certificate, provisional certificate along with mark sheets pertaining to all the academic semester/years will be accepted.
- Caste certificate issued by Govt. of Assam for candidate seeking reservation as SC/ST/OBC/MOBC, from the competent authority indicating clearly the candidate’s Caste, the Act/Order under which the Caste is recognized as SC/ST/OBC/MOBC and the village/town the candidate is ordinarily a resident of.
- BPL certificate issued by Govt. of Assam. (Wherever necessary).
- The candidates will have to submit Declaration Form-A, related to the Assam Public Services (Application of Small Family norms in Direct Recruitment) Rules, 2019 published vide Notification No:ABP.69/2019/17 dated Dispur, the 6th November/2019 which may be downloaded from the official website of APSC www.apsc.nic.in (Forms & Downloads Section)
- Documentary support for any other claim(s) made.
NOTE I: Date of birth mentioned in Online Recruitment Application is final. No subsequent request for change of date of birth will be considered or granted. No document other than the Class X/Class XII Board Examination Admit Card/Pass Certificate/Marksheet, in which the date of birth is properly recorded, will be accepted by the Commission for determination of age.
NOTE II: Candidates are warned that they should not furnish any particulars that are false or suppress any material information in filling up the application form. Candidates are also warned that they should in no case correct or alter or otherwise tamper with any entry in a document or its attested/certified copy submitted by them nor should they submit a tampered/fabricated document. If there is any inaccuracy or any discrepancy between two or more such documents or their attested/certified copies, an explanation regarding this discrepancy should be submitted.
NOTE III: Candidates must ensure that they upload all necessary documents before final submission. No documents will be accepted after final submission of application. No other request for document submission will be entertained once the online application process is over.
